Ashokan Rail Trail- Woodstock Dike Trailhead

Ashokan Rail Trail- Woodstock Dike Trailhead

1285 New York 28, West Hurley, NY 12491

An 11.5-mile recreational trail runs along the Ashokan Reservoir between West Hurley and Boiceville. The reservoir supplies 40% of NYC's water! Three convenient entrances with parking can be accessed in West Hurley, Shokan-you can rent bikes from Overlook Bicycles (845-657-4001)across the street from the Shokan entrance or Boiceville.

Opus 40

Opus 40

356 George Sickle Road, Saugerties, NY 12477

A 12 acre bluestone quarry turned into a beautiful sculpture park by Harvey Fite , founder of the fine arts program at Bard College. This sculpture park took almost 40 years to create!
